How To Fix CNV_20900179 - Check for account group:


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CNV_20900 - Message class for package CNV_20900

  • Message number: 179

  • Message text: Check for account group:

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CNV_20900179 - Check for account group: ?

    The SAP error message CNV_20900179 typically relates to issues encountered during data migration or conversion processes, particularly when using the SAP S/4HANA Migration Cockpit or similar tools. This specific error indicates that there is a problem with the account group configuration in the system.

    Cause:

    The error message CNV_20900179 Check for account group usually arises due to one or more of the following reasons:

    1. Missing Account Group: The account group specified in the migration data does not exist in the target system.
    2. Incorrect Configuration: The account group may not be properly configured or may not be compatible with the data being migrated.
    3.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data being migrated, such as invalid references to account groups.
    4. Authorization Issues: The user performing the migration may not have the necessary authorizations to access or modify the account groups.

    Solution:

    To resolve the error CNV_20900179, you can follow these steps:

    1. Verify Account Group:

      • Check if the account group mentioned in the error message exists in the target system.
      • Use transaction code OBD4 to display the account groups and ensure that the required account group is present.
    2. Check Configuration:

      • Ensure that the account group is correctly configured. This includes checking the settings for the account group in the relevant configuration transactions (e.g., OBAY for G/L account groups).
      • Make sure that the account group is assigned to the correct company code and is set up for the intended use (e.g., customer, vendor, G/L accounts).
    3. Review Migration Data:

      • Inspect the data being migrated for any inconsistencies or errors related to account groups.
      • Ensure that the data format and values match the expected configuration in the target system.
    4. Authorization Check:

      • Verify that the user performing the migration has the necessary authorizations to access and modify account groups.
      • If needed, consult with your SAP security team to ensure proper roles and permissions are assigned.
    5.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to the SAP documentation or notes related to the specific migration process you are using. There may be additional guidelines or prerequisites that need to be followed.
    6. Testing:

      • After making the necessary adjustments, perform a test migration to see if the error persists.
